International Crisis Group Revenue and Competitors

Location

N/A

Total Funding

Trade

Industry

Estimated Revenue & Valuation

  • International Crisis Group's estimated annual revenue is currently $15M per year.(i)
  • International Crisis Group's estimated revenue per employee is $41,436

Employee Data

  • International Crisis Group has 362 Employees.(i)
  • International Crisis Group grew their employee count by 9% last year.

International Crisis Group's People

NameTitleEmail/Phone
1
Chief AdvocacyReveal Email/Phone
2
Chief External AffairsReveal Email/Phone
3
General CounselReveal Email/Phone
4
IT OfficerReveal Email/Phone
5
Head Communications and Outreach for North AmericaReveal Email/Phone
6
Program Director, Russia and Central AsiaReveal Email/Phone
7
Director Foundation RelationsReveal Email/Phone
8
Deputy Director PolicyReveal Email/Phone
9
Deputy Director Latin America and the CaribbeanReveal Email/Phone
10
Director, North Africa ProjectReveal Email/Phone
Competitor NameRevenueNumber of EmployeesEmployee GrowthTotal FundingValuation
#1
$3.5M297%N/AN/A
#2
$75M1526N/AN/AN/A
#3
$7.5M11310%N/AN/A
#4
N/A2713%N/AN/A
#5
$35M9000%N/AN/A
#6
$7.5M880%N/AN/A
#7
N/A23-4%N/AN/A
#8
$15M3629%N/AN/A
#9
$7.5M1106%N/AN/A
#10
$3.5M1749%N/AN/A
Add Company

What Is International Crisis Group?

Non-Profit & Professional Orgs.

keywords:N/A

N/A

Total Funding

362

Number of Employees

$15M

Revenue (est)

9%

Employee Growth %

N/A

Valuation

N/A

Accelerator

International Crisis Group News

2022-04-17 - An Agenda for the UN Secretary-General's Trip to Russia and ...

Crisis Group understands that President Putin has since turned down a ... to the war's impact on global food, energy and commodity prices.

2022-04-17 - $20m Grant Aims to Combine Local Voices and Global ...

Crisis Group is the go-to organisation for ideas on how to prevent or end deadly conflicts. It is a trusted source of analysis and actionable...

2022-04-17 - Open Letter to the U.S. and Iranian Leadership about the Iran ...

This open letter has been signed by members of the European Leadership Network, Board members of the International Crisis Group and Council...

Company NameRevenueNumber of EmployeesEmployee GrowthTotal Funding
#1
$95M3627%N/A
#2
$81.5M362N/AN/A
#3
$122.2M3623%N/A
#4
$15M3626%N/A
#5
$35M364N/AN/A